One thing I thought was interesting though was when I drove with Javi to get his drivers license. We had to be there at nine in the morning and good thing I took a book with me because we did not get back home until two o clock. First thing  in the morning everyone had to go into a room and watch a video that would help them pass the test. After they had to go to a parking lot to take a driving test. Well you would think that you would bring your car so that you could pass a driving test right? Wrong, half of the people taking the test had to use our blazer because they did not have a car of their own. The teacher set up two cones a couple feet apart in the parking lot and everyone had to take their turns trying to parallel park. Half of the people did not pass this part of the test and one guy did not even know how to turn the truck on. I felt bad because while you took your turn everyone was standing on the side watching to see if you would pass. Talk about working under pressure. Javi was done in two minutes thank God and then we had to wait about two more hours for him to take the test on the computer, take his photo, and his fingerprints. One good thing was they just hand you your drivers license before you leave. Well that has been my excitment for the week, hope I wil be sharing some good news with you for my next post.
